Diabetes mellitus, a chronic metabolic disorder, significantly augments the risk of cardiovascular disease (CVD). As healthcare professionals, understanding these risks and managing them effectively is critical to improving patient outcomes.
Assessment of cardiovascular risk in diabetic patients involves a comprehensive evaluation of traditional risk factors, such as hypertension, dyslipidemia, and smoking. Additionally, factors specific to diabetes, like glycemic control, duration of diabetes, and presence of microvascular complications, should be considered. Tools like the UKPDS Risk Engine can help quantify CVD risk in these patients.
Management strategies should aim to mitigate modifiable risk factors. Blood pressure and lipid control, along with glycemic management, form the cornerstone of CVD risk reduction. Statin therapy is recommended for most patients with diabetes, given its proven benefit in reducing CVD events. ACE inhibitors or ARBs are also beneficial in patients with diabetes and hypertension.
Lifestyle modifications, including diet, exercise, and weight management, are integral to managing cardiovascular risk in diabetic patients. A diet rich in fruits, vegetables, whole grains, and lean proteins, along with regular physical activity, can significantly reduce CVD risk. Smoking cessation is also imperative.
Empowering patients with knowledge about their condition is crucial. They should be educated about the importance of regular monitoring, medication adherence, and lifestyle changes. Regular follow-ups and monitoring of HbA1c, blood pressure, and lipid profile are essential.
In conclusion, effectively assessing and managing cardiovascular risk in diabetic patients is a multifaceted approach that requires a comprehensive evaluation of risk factors, implementation of pharmacological and non-pharmacological interventions, and patient education. By doing so, healthcare professionals can significantly improve the cardiovascular health of their diabetic patients.
